Located in the foothills of Dartmoor, the traditional market town of Okehampton, 2 miles away, is surrounded by spectacular countryside that you’ll have a ball exploring on foot or two wheels if your four-pawed pal can keep up. Discover Okehampton’s quaint selection of cafes and restaurants, sniffing out some delicious local produce before exploring the remains of the second oldest Norman Castle in the county, Okehampton Castle (1.5 miles), which offers lots of exciting new smells and panoramic views across the River Okement. Keen walkers can take the lead to conquer Dartmoor’s Yes Tor or High Willhays, both reached within 10.5 miles.
